Storage & Handling
- Storage Conditions
- However, duetotheir high specific surface area, theycan absorb moistureand volatile organic compounds from the surrounding atmosphere. Therefore, were commend storing the products in sealed containers in a dry, coolplace, and removed from volatile organic substances.
- Even if a product is stored under these conditions, after a longer period it can still pickup ambient moisture over time, which could lead toits exceeding thespecified moisture content.
- For this reason, our recommended use-bydate is 24 months after dateof manufacture.
- Products more than 24 months old should be tested for moisture content before use in order to make certain that it is still suitable for the intended application.
